The Minutes is a weekly exploration of Thunder Bay’s City Council meetings. Each episode features an overview of the latest meeting, plus engaging interviews with city staff and administration, providing detailed insights and perspectives beyond traditional news coverage. “The Minutes” is presented by the City of Thunder Bay and is not politically affiliated with individual councillors.

  1. September 8, 2026 - Standing Committees Recap & Traffic Study Insights from The Minutes, opens in a new tab

    Sep 10, 202624 min

    Host Amy Stasiewicz recaps the key highlights and decisions from the recent Quality of Life and Finance & Administration Standing Committee meetings. David Binch, Traffic Technologist with the City of Thunder Bay, joins the Minutes to discuss traffic studies, transportation planning, and the recent River Terrace parking review. Learn how traffic and parking decisions are made and the role data plays in shaping safe, efficient transportation throughout our community.

  4. August 20, 2026 - City Council Recap & Part 2: Behind the Scenes of Emergency Management from The Minutes, opens in a new tab

    Aug 20, 202624 min

    Host Amy Stasiewicz recaps key updates from the August 11 City Council meeting. We also continue our conversation with Robert Wark, Division Chief of Administration and Community Emergency Management Coordinator with Thunder Bay Fire Rescue. In Part 2, he shares how the City of Thunder Bay plans for emergencies, coordinates response efforts, and works to keep residents safe. He also discusses the importance of personal emergency preparedness, including having an emergency kit ready and a plan in place before an emergency occurs. With recent wildfires affecting communities across Northern Ontario, this timely conversation highlights the shared responsibility between individuals, families, and emergency responders in building a resilient community.

  5. Part 1: Behind the Scenes of Emergency Management from The Minutes, opens in a new tab

    Aug 7, 202625 min

    In this episode of The Minutes, Robert Wark, Division Chief of Administration and Community Emergency Management Coordinator with Thunder Bay Fire Rescue, discusses the City of Thunder Bay's Emergency Management Program and the work that happens behind the scenes to prepare for and respond to emergencies. With recent wildfires affecting communities across Northern Ontario, emergency preparedness and coordinated response efforts remain more important than ever. This is Part 1 of 2. Stay tuned for Part 2, coming in the next few weeks, as the conversation continues.
